This patch add exynos3250 compatible string to exynos_cpufreq_matches
for supporting generic cpufreq driver on Exynos3250.

 arch/arm/mach-exynos/exynos.c |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/arch/arm/mach-exynos/exynos.c b/arch/arm/mach-exynos/exynos.c
index 4015ec369ae5..77ac0216ddc4 100644
--- a/arch/arm/mach-exynos/exynos.c
+++ b/arch/arm/mach-exynos/exynos.c
@@ -225,6 +225,7 @@ static void __init exynos_init_irq(void)
 }
 
 static const struct of_device_id exynos_cpufreq_matches[] = {
+       { .compatible = "samsung,exynos3250", .data = "cpufreq-dt" },
        { .compatible = "samsung,exynos4210", .data = "cpufreq-dt" },
        { .compatible = "samsung,exynos5250", .data = "cpufreq-dt" },
        { /* sentinel */ }
